Abstract

Power-referenced in-fiber edge filter based on a linearly chirped and weakly tilted fiber Bragg grating is proposed. It provides a smooth transfer function with 0.7 dB/nm of discrimination over C-band for the temperature-self-compensated FBG interrogation.
